Barbara was every bit the famous socialite of the Inner Side. Her expression stiffened for only a moment before her coquettish, amorous smile returned.

"Of course. When I return to the Hestia Family, I’ll discuss this matter with Elder Pence."

’"Discuss this matter?" Yeah, right. The Dragon Eater Association is almost certainly making their move tonight; we might not even live to see tomorrow... Speaking of which, this woman, Barbara Hestia... If I’m not mistaken, wasn’t she the one in the Magic Power Carriage last time, the one who was screaming for me to take her? It couldn’t be, could it?’

Last time on the Magic Train, he hadn’t paid much attention to Barbara—nicknamed the "Extremely Enchanting Witch" by those on the Inner Side—because the lights had been too dim, the train too fast, and the battle too fierce. Now that he had a clear look at her, he had to admit the nickname was fitting. The woman was a total vixen.

Baron’s gaze subconsciously fell to Barbara’s ample chest. Although things had moved quickly on the Magic Train, thanks to a Dragon Knight’s superhuman vision, he had caught a fleeting glimpse when she threw herself at him, and the memory was still fresh.

Miss Barbara chuckled, lightly covering her chest with a handkerchief.

"Miss Freya, it seems your attendant has some wandering eyes."

"I’ll gouge his eyes out when we get back," Freya said, her tone as haughty as ever.

It seemed Baron’s decision to have her just be herself had been the right one after all.

But just then, Isabella cut in. "If you’re afraid of having your eyes gouged out, Sir Attendant, how about defecting to my Beowulf Clan? I can cover the entire cost of breaking your contract."

"You’re overstepping, Miss Isabella. Are all the members of the Beowulf Clan so shameless?" Freya sneered.

Isabella retorted, "At least that’s better than a certain someone who announced her broken engagement in the papers."

Freya flared up. "Do you have any idea what you’re saying, Miss Isabella? Is this how the Beowulf Clan treats its partners?"

The Beowulf Clan and Lancelot’s Family did indeed have a business partnership, mainly in the wholesale of raw materials for Magic Potions and Magic Staffs—in other words, the various body parts of Dragon Descendants.

"Soon, we won’t be," Isabella said coolly.

Freya froze, then immediately understood the hidden meaning in Isabella’s words.

Freya’s gaze toward Isabella shifted. ’This woman, half Old Blood and half Bloodless... has she really been chosen as a candidate for the next Patriarch of the Beowulf Clan?’

"So I advise you to watch yourself, Miss Lancelot," Isabella said, resting her chin on her hand, her expression apathetic and disdainful. "Not everyone is going to spoil you like your brother and fiancé do."

"That’s because you don’t have anyone to spoil you," Freya retorted, her words as sharp as ever.

Isabella raised an eyebrow. "Hm?"

The air crackled with tension. Just as the two women seemed ready to clash again, Lucy hurriedly stepped in to mediate, defusing the situation slightly.

From beginning to end, the attendant at the center of the dispute showed no expression, much to the envy of the surrounding men. He simply looked at the ceiling, the floor, and around the venue, thinking, ’This auction hall is inhumanly extravagant.’

This behavior, however, made Barbara take a keen interest in the seemingly ordinary man, especially after seeing him defeat Elder Pence’s guard in a single move and now remain completely unfazed while being fought over by the legitimate daughters of two Old Blood Clans.

"Miss Freya, if you ask me, your attendant seems to be enjoying being surrounded by women," Barbara suddenly purred.
